Mikel, Chukwueze out – See Super Eagles line up vs Guinea

Facebook Twitter Pinterest LinkedIn Tumblr Email
Eagles
Share
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Pinterest Email

Nigeria have released a strong starting Super Eagles XI to tackle Guinea in today’s 2019 Africa Cup of Nations, AFCON, second Group B tie at Alexandria Stadium.

Head coach of Nigeria, Gernot Rohr has released a list of eleven players to start the match against the Syli Stars.

 

Rohr dropped captain John Obi Mikel and Villarreal sensation Samuel Chukwueze from the starting line-up.

Nigeria head to the match after defeating Burundi 1-0 over the weekend while Guinea played a 2-2 draw against Madagascar.

 

Nigeria and Guinea have met 17 times in the past with the Super Eagles winning five, drawing seven and losing five.

Below is Nigeria’s starting XI against Guinea:

 

Akpeyi, Omeruo, Balogun, Aina, Awaziem, Ndidi, Etebo, Iwobi, Musa, Simon, Ighalo

 

The kick-off time for the match is 3:30 pm.
